Full job description
Functional Assessor: Suitable for NMC and HCPC Adult registered Nurses, Paramedics, Occupational Therapist and Physiotherapist – with 12-months of recent UK post qualification experience.
Starting salary of £43,875
Working hours – Fulltime only: Monday – Friday 09:00 – 17:30
Hybrid model of working – 3 days per week onsite and 2 days from your home address.
About you!
Are you a registered health care professional, in one of the above registrations, with 12 months post qualification experience working in the UK?
Are you looking for a role, where you can adapt your clinical and hands on experience into a desk based, assessment only position and not lose any of your precious clinical skills – in fact you will probably gain even more knowledge!
Are you interested in a job that ensures you are using your clinical skills daily with continual CPD and skill progression along the way?
And best yet! Are you ready to work a daytime shift, with no shift patterns, no on call and bank holidays off!
If so, then a Disability Assessor may be the perfect option for you!
What you need:
You will need to be confident with using a computer as the role is 50% administrative report writing and using a variety of systems and report-based templates.
You will need to be confident in your clinical knowledge of both physical and mental illness.
To be able to reliably commute to to your nearest location at least 3 days per week.
12 months of post registered experience as an Adult Nurse, Physiotherapist, Occupational therapist or Paramedic Is a must!
Full right to work in the UK - Sorry but we don't currently offer sponsorship for this role!
What will you be doing?
Seeing clients, with numerous health concerns, assessing them based on both physical and mental health conditions. Using your clinical skills and assessing based purely on clinical evidence.
You will be assessing individuals holistically, to understand their need and requirements to obtain Personal independence payments. The personal independence payment will support the client with everyday tasks and costs, incurred following their conditions diagnosis.
With a thorough training induction and plenty of support along the way, you are in great hands, to start your journey as a PIP Disability Assessor.
The training induction is for 7 weeks full time, and you must be able to commit to the full 7 weeks, without holiday or ad-hoc days taken during this time - if applying for this role, be sure to let your Recruiter know of any pre booked leave you may have.
